About

Read Better Be Better Reading Programs began as an afterschool reading comprehension and leadership program that paired 3rd grade readers with middle school leaders. The program now offers a comprehensive reading program that involves kindergarten through 3rd grade readers, 4th through 8th grade student leaders, and high school students in specific leadership pathways. High school students can participate by assisting Program Coaches in the afterschool reading program or by taking part in a civic leadership curriculum.

Read Better Be Better is a nonprofit organization based in Phoenix, Arizona, founded in 2014 as a response to the state’s literacy crisis. Its mission is love of literacy and leadership. Over time, the organization has expanded to serve students from kindergarten through 12th grade. Readers in kindergarten through 3rd grade work on foundational literacy skills, while students in 4th through 8th grade build on their leadership skills by helping younger readers engage with literacy. The Pathways to Education Professions Program provides high school students with paid internship opportunities to work alongside Read Better Be Better staff during afterschool literacy sessions. The Pathways to Civic Leadership Program guides high school students through a curriculum focused on leadership development, community engagement, civic engagement, and social responsibility.
